The first garden gnomes were made is germany in the mid-1800s. They were made of terrocotta and were created based on the myths and local stories of how gnomes were willing to help in the garden at night. The Gardebn Gnome quickly spread across Germany., and into France and England, and whereever gardening was a serious hobby.
Traditional gnomes are made from terrocotta clay slurry poured into molds. The gnome is removed from the mold and allowed to dry, and then fired in a kiln until it became hard. Once cooled the gnomes are painted to the level of detail desired and sent to stores to be sold. More moders gnomes are made from resins and similiar materials.
Garden gnomes have become a popular acccessory in many gardens. They are often the target of pranks. People have been known to return garden gnomes to the wild. Some kidnapped Garden gnomes have been sent on trips around the world, (The Traveling Gnome Prank; this later became the basis of the Travelocity Roaming Gnome).
Gnomes are deplicted as having beards and are wearing red hats. Garden Gnomes are typically male and are made in various poses pursuing pastimes, such as fishing and napping.
